Laphroaig 10 Year Old Cask Strength Batch #15 is a collectable Scotch whisky from Laphroaig aged 10 years. Based on 37 recorded auction lots across 24 months of trading data, the current median hammer price is £54, with the most recent sale at £50. Over the trading window, prices have ranged from £45 (low) to £70 (high). Accounting for lot-to-lot variation, a realistic valuation range for Laphroaig 10 Year Old Cask Strength Batch #15 is £45–£55 (±9% around the latest sale).
Year-on-year, Laphroaig 10 Year Old Cask Strength Batch #15 is up 0%, with a 6-month trend of -2.4% (down). wsky1 aggregates hammer prices from major public Scotch whisky auctions including Scotch Whisky Auctions, Whisky Auctioneer, and Bonhams. All prices are in GBP and exclude buyer's premium (typically 24–28% additional at major houses). Past auction performance is not a guarantee of future value.

At most major houses, buyer's premium adds 24–28% on top of hammer for the buyer; sellers typically receive the hammer price minus a sales commission of 5–15%.

wsky1 ingests public auction results from major auction houses (via direct scraping of Scotch Whisky Auctions, Whisky Auctioneer, Bonhams, and Whisky Hammer, plus aggregated data from WhiskyHunter). For each bottle, we group hammer prices by year-month and compute the median price per month. The figures shown — latest £50, 24-month median £54 — are derived from this monthly-median methodology. All prices are hammer prices in GBP, excluding buyer's premium.
